+ /*
+ * When we WAL-logged index pages, we must nonetheless fsync index files.
+ * Since we're building outside shared buffers, a CHECKPOINT occurring
+ * during the build has no way to flush the previously written data to
+ * disk (indeed it won't know the index even exists). A crash later on
+ * would replay WAL from the checkpoint, therefore it wouldn't replay our
+ * earlier WAL entries. If we do not fsync those pages here, they might
+ * still not be on disk when the crash occurs.
+ */
+ if (RelationNeedsWAL(state->indexrel))
+ smgrimmedsync(RelationGetSmgr(state->indexrel), MAIN_FORKNUM);
